About Malay Falls, Nova Scotia

Malay Falls is a community in Halifax, Nova Scotia, Canada. It is classified as a village / hamlet. Malay Falls is located at 44.9868°N, 62.4822°W.

Malay Falls sits cradled within the rugged contours of the Hemlock Hill, where the Atlantic coast air carries a sharp, salt-heavy chill across the landscape. It lies 42.9 km west-south-west of Sherbrooke, NS (from Sherbrooke, NS: bearing 246°T), and is situated 8.3 km north-north-east of Sheet Harbour. The Grant River carves a persistent path through the terrain, its currents rushing over the rocks with a low, constant percussion that defines the acoustic signature of the woods. Nearby, the stillness of Upper Beaver Harbour Lake offers a stark contrast to the kinetic energy of the water, while the presence of Ruth Falls nearby adds another layer of vertical movement to the region.
